Sheridan Lake, CO โ€”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about Sheridan Lake demographics

What is the population of Sheridan Lake, Colorado?

According to the US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ates (2022), the population of Sheridan Lake, Colorado is 56.

What is the median household income in Sheridan Lake?

The median household income in Sheridan Lake, Colorado is $58,125 per year, according to the 2022 ACS 5-Year Estimates. The US national median household income is approximately $74,580.

What is the median home value in Sheridan Lake?

The median home value in Sheridan Lake, Colorado is $73,300, compared to the national median of approximately $281,900.

What is the average age in Sheridan Lake?

The median age in Sheridan Lake, Colorado is 26.8 years, compared to the US national median age of approximately 38.9 years.
